Closed-Form Solutions and the Eigenvalue Problem for Vibration of Discrete Viscoelastic Systems

A procedure for obtaining closed-form homogeneous solutions for the problem of vibration of a discrete viscoelastic system is developed for the case where the relaxation kernel characterizing the constitutive relation of the material is expressible as a sum of exponentials. The developed procedure involves the formulation of an eigenvalue problem and avoids difficulties encountered with the application of the Laplace transform approach to multi-degree-of-freedom viscoelastic systems. Analytical results computed by using the developed method are demonstrated on an example of a viscoelastic beam.
